Anora Group Plc   Stock exchange release   20 August 2024 at 8.35 a.m. EEST

Changes in Anora Group’s Executive Management Team: The Head of Anora’s Industrial segment to change

Anora Group’s Senior Vice President, Industrial, Risto Gaggl steps down from his position. He will continue in his current role with Anora until the end of 2024. Anora has appointed Hannu Vähämurto as his successor as of 1 January 2025.

Hannu Vähämurto has been with Anora and its predecessor (Altia Oyj) since 2011 in various roles, most recently as Director, Industrial Products since September 2023. Prior to this, he has acted as Manufacturing Operations & Planning Director and Supply Chain Director, among others. Prior to joining Anora, he gained extensive experience from various manufacturing and supply chain management positions at Tellabs Oy.

Risto Gaggl joined Anora in October 2023 and has acted as Anora’s Senior Vice President, Industrial, and member of Anora’s Executive Management Team since 1 January 2024. Risto remains highly committed to contribute to the company’s success during his notice period, including ensuring a smooth handover to his successor and overseeing the Supply Chain operations until the year-end.

“On behalf of the Management Team and all our colleagues, I want to thank Risto for his valuable contribution in developing the segment and reducing production footprint complexity of the company. We wish him all the best in his future endeavours. Looking forward, I am extremely happy to have Hannu take the lead in Anora’s Industrial segment and join our Executive Management Team as of next year. His strong background in supply chain management and industrial operations planning is key to our success over the coming years,” says Jacek Pastuszka, CEO of Anora.

“I’m very excited about this opportunity. We have a great team in the Industrial business and I’m greatly looking forward to continuing our work together in my new role in January,” says Hannu Vähämurto.

Two additional changes in Anora Group’s Executive Management Team will also come into effect as of today. Johanna Sundén, the current Chief HR Officer, will assume the responsibility for Group Communications in addition to her HR responsibilities as Chief People and Communications Officer (CPCO). Furthermore, Thomas Heinonen, Group General Counsel, will become a member of Anora Group’s Executive Management Team. Thomas has been with Anora and its predecessor (Altia Oyj) as Group General Counsel since 2012.

Anora is a leading wine and spirits brand house in the Nordic region and a global industry forerunner in sustainability. Our market-leading portfolio consists of our own iconic Nordic brands and a wide range of prominent international partner wines and spirits. We export to over 30 markets globally. Anora Group also includes Anora Industrial and logistics company Vectura. In 2023, Anora’s net sales were EUR 726.5 million and the company employs about 1,200 professionals. Anora’s shares are listed on Nasdaq Helsinki.
